>I have a sql server table with 85K rows, a sales order line item file. Unfortunately for this application, it is difficult to come up with parameter conditions to limit the # of rows to retrieve - it makes more sense to download the whole file for the application I am working with.
I highly suggest that you find something to limit the amount of data that you will be retrieving. If you don't, you will be creating performance issues. What's a user going to do with 85,000 rows? How would they go about finding a specific set of rows? Can you not force some kind of search specs such as a date range, customer number, employee number, country code, something?!?!
